Facebook used in murder for hire plot


I guess we shouldn’t be surprised that since Facebook has 500 million users, not all of them would be geniuses. Recently a man was arrested in West Chester PA for posting on Facebook that he wanted to hire someone to kill a girl who was bringing him up on rape charges.
Besides the obvious points that murder and rape are wrong, you have to wonder what he was thinking.  This is an extreme example of what many people do on their social media profiles every day which is share too much.
I understand the object of being social is to interact with friends and family with aspects of your life. But somewhere in the translation it was either lost or we have become immune to the fact that a lot people can read what we post. Not only can they read it, but they can save it and share it with their friends.
On top of that when this is pointed out to most people they actually seem shocked. It has become such a part of our culture to put out information we don’t stop to think who has access to this material and what will they do with it. You see other examples of this when people post information or pictures and it’s seen by their employers and causes them trouble at work or costs them their jobs.
Social media can be an amazing way to connect with people but never forget that your posts can have a huge impact and last in search engines for a long time to be found by anyone who is looking.
